This morning on Amy Goodman's Democracy Now, in the grand
jury case of Michael Brown, we learned that Witness #40 clearly fabricated her
testimony that verified the testimony of police officer Darren Wilson, who said that
Michael "charged him like a football player". But we also learned that Witness #40, one Sandra McElroy, has some
mental-health problems, a history of racial animosity on social media, got a 3-year probation sentence for "bad checks", and has a history of ingratiating
herself into high-profile cases falsely.
Her reason given for being right there on the scene when
Michael was murdered was that she decided to visit an old friend from school she
hadn't heard from in 26 years and that she wanted to do a personal study of
Afro-Americans because in her words, "so that she would stop calling them
niggers and begin treating them like human beings." When asked why her automobile was not spotted by the many
webcams in the area at the time of the shooting she said she didn't
know.
When asked by the prosecutors in the grand jury how she got
into a predominantly black neighborhood as a white woman, she described her
route and how she exited. It was right off of a Google map. Only problem was
that the exit route had been blocked off for over two years and there was only
one way out.... which of course she didn't take.
She was the key witness who described Michael as crouching
down and charging like a football player would, corroborating Darren Wilson's description of the incident.
But there's more of where this came from. Witness #10, no
name, a white man working in the area, claimed originally in the police report
that he saw the two young men walking on the sidewalk coming in his direction.
He later changed that testimony to that he saw them walking in the street next
to the sidewalk. His testimony in the police report was that at no time did
Michael raise his hands, that he made a gesture before charging Darren Wilson
from 100 yards. He later change that testimony to 50 yards.
